The Plymouth Ladewig-Zinkgraf American Legion Post 243 will be hosting the 2024 Plymouth Memorial Day Parade. The parade is scheduled for Monday, May 27th, 2024. Step off time is scheduled for 10:00 AM and the route will follow Mill Street from Caroline Street to North Street and end at Union Cemetery. Program Details:
The program at Union Cemetery will feature the Plymouth High School band directed by Cody Wisman, invocation by Father Subi Thomas pastor of St. John the Baptist Catholic church Plymouth and St Thomas Aquinas Catholic church Elkhart Lake.
Poppy Princess is Sidney Arndt
Guest speaker will be Frederick Phelps US Army and graduate of the Defense Language Institute Foreign Language Center at the Presidio of Monterey California.
The emcee of the program will be Rev. Thomas Fleischmann.
*In case of rain the program will move to Riverview Middle School at 10:00 AM.
